> the main concern is two ACL connections with two different devices,at
> the same time.
>
> Basically it would be helpfull,if we get to know from you guys ,if the
> behaviour we notice is a bug(connecting to two different devices at
> the same time) or works as designed.


That is working as designed. The user can have a HFP connection to one
device, and an A2DP connection to another.
